South Jersey Resources Group to Supply Fuel Management Services
to Moxie Liberty Facility

HAMMONTON, NJ - South Jersey Industries, (NYSE:SJI), the energy holding company for South Jersey Gas and South Jersey Energy Solutions, announced that SJES' subsidiary, South Jersey Resources Group, has executed a 5-year contract to supply fuel management services with Moxie Liberty LLC.

The proposed facility developed by Moxie Energy, LLC and recently acquired and financed by Panda Power Funds, is a planned 829 megawatt natural gas-fueled, combined-cycle generating station located in Bradford County Pennsylvania. Commercial operations are expected to begin by early 2016.

Michael Renna, president, South Jersey Energy Solutions said, "SJRG's commodity marketing program, specifically within the Marcellus Shale region, has allowed us to link generators to abundant and affordable new natural gas supplies. This project is a prime example of this effort and our participation in Marcellus marketing will allow us to continue pursuing these types of deals."

Under the terms of the contract, SJRG will be the exclusive provider of natural gas supplies and services associated with managing those supplies for the generating station.

About Panda Power Funds, LP

Founded in 2010, Panda Power Funds is a private equity firm headquartered in Dallas, Texas, which has the ability to develop, acquire, construct, finance and operate large-scale, natural gas-fueled power generation facilities. Panda's first fund invested in three combined-cycle power plants currently under construction in Temple and Sherman, Texas (totaling 2,274 megawatts) and a 20-megawatt solar project in operation in Pilesgrove, New Jersey.
